Ley Elevates Duniam to Shadow Home Affairs in Targeted Frontbench Reshuffle

The move concentrates the Coalition's scrutiny on Labor's Home Affairs record after Andrew Hastie's resignation.

Overview

  • Opposition Leader Sussan Ley announced a narrow reshuffle that installs Tasmanian senator Jonno Duniam as shadow home affairs minister.
  • Duniam criticised the Albanese government over the return of a small group referred to as 'ISIS brides', alleging a lack of transparency and accountability.
  • Julian Leeser moved from shadow attorney-general to shadow education and early learning while retaining the arts portfolio.
  • Queensland MP Andrew Wallace was appointed shadow attorney-general, with Ley nominating Philip Thompson to replace him on the intelligence and security committee.
  • Zoe McKenzie was promoted to shadow cabinet secretary as Aaron Violi and Cameron Caldwell entered the assistant shadow ministry in communications, housing and mental health.
